Answer:
The answer for each requiremnt is given below.
1. Accounts Payable
both debit and credit entries-credit when buying good on account and debit when paying cash against it.
2. Accounts Receivable
both debit and credit entries-debit when selling good on account and credit when paying cash against it.
3. Cash
both debit and credit entries-credit when making payments and debit when receiving cash income.
4. Fees Earned
credit entries only- as fees is earned.
5. Insurance Expense
Debit entries only - as expense is incurred.
6. Steve Campbell, Drawing
Debit entries only - when Steve draws amount from business.
7. Utilities Expense
Debit entries only - as expense is incurred.

Answer:
$245 per participant
Explanation:
total number of participants = 200
total costs for 200 participants:
- $40 per night x 3 nights x 200 = $24,000 for rooms
- $3,000 for insurance
- $6,000 for meals
total costs = $33,000
if you want to earn $16,000 in profits ($8,000 each),
price per participant = ($33,000 + $16,000) / 200 = $49,000 / 200 = $245
